RESOLUTION NO.1903
A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Y OF MARYSVILLE GRANTING A UTILITY
VARIANCE FOR BOYDEN, ROBINETT &ASSOCIATES FOR PROPERTY
LOCATED APPROXIMATELY 1/2 MILE WESTOF THE 108TH STREETN.E.AND
67TH AVENUE N.E. INTERSECTION AT 5916 -108TH STREET N.E.,
MARYSVILLE,WASHINGTON.
WHEREAS,on August 17,1998 BOYDEN,ROBINETT &ASSOCIATES
applied for a utility variance for 34 water connections and 34
sewer connections for property located approximately 1/2 mile
west of the 108th Street N.E.and 67th Avenue N.E.intersection
at 5916 -108th Street N.E.,Marysville,Washington;and
WHEREAS,on October 5,1998,the City Council of the City of
Marysville held a public meeting concerning the variance
application and made the following findings:
1.The property is within the City'S CWSP boundary and the
City's Urban Growth boundary.The property is outside of the
City's RUSA boundary.
2.There is an 8-inch water main east of 56th Avenue N.E.
on 108th Street.In order to receive water service,the
applicant will need to cover the frontage of his property on
108th Street N.E.and loop the system to the water main in the
Plat of Kellogg Village,which is presently under construction.
Sanitary sewer can be provided.by extension of the sanitary sewer
being in stalled in the Plat of Kellogg Village.
3.The extension of the utility to the applicant's site is
consistent with the sanitary sewer comprehensive plan for this
area.
4.In light of the above-referenced findings,the
authorization of the variance will not be materially detrimental
to the public interest,welfare,or the environment.
5.The above-referenced findings reflect exceptional or
extraordinary circumstances or conditions applying to the subject
property that do not apply generally to other properties in the
same vicinity.

NOW,TH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E
CITY OF MARYSVILLE,WASHINGTON AS FOLLOWS:
1.The applicant's variance is hereby granted subject to
the following conditions:
a.The applicant's request for water and sewer
connection shall be approved without specifying a specific
number of connections.The approval of this utility
variance shall be subject to the number of utility
connections being consistent with the densities provided in
the Marysville Comprehensive Plan as it now reads or is
hereinafter amended.
b.The applicant shall pay all applicable fees
required by Title 14 of the Marysville Municipal Code and
shall comply with all other requirements of City ordinance
including,but not limited to,the execution of an
annexation covenant pursuant to MMC 14.32.040.
2.This decision shall be final and conclusive with the
right of appeal by any aggrieved party to the Superior Court of
Snohomish County by filing a Land Use Petition pursuant to the
Land Use Petition Act within twenty-one (21)days after the
passage of this resolution.
